Sorry. I missed this post.
If you visit the Logitech web site (by default it will go to India, change location to USA), you will get many details. In short the main features of this mouse are:
a) The scroll wheel senses what application you are currently active on and the mode changes automatically. For example, if you are on a text editor (notepad/textpad), the scroll wheel behaves like the normal ratchet/clank type. If you switch to internet browser or acrobat reader, it changes to hyper scrolling. The mode can be changed manually by press/click on the wheel.
b) The second wheel on the side is to switch between application windows (like Alt-Tab).
c) There are two buttons on the side that work as forward/backward buttons.
d) A button just below the main (center) scroll wheel acts as a web search. Highlight any word in a screen/document and press this button. It will use your default browser and default search engine to bring that up.
Plus it is ergonomic and feels good in the hand. It is worth every bit of rupees (or dollars) spent.
